"Give It All To God"

"There shall no strange god be in thee; neither shalt thou worship any strange god." (Psalms 81:9) If you think you know it all, you had better check yourself very carefully, because your fooling yourself and you don't even know it. I can't begin to tell you all the crazy messed up things I have heard from people who say that they are believers. Not that I am not guilty of saying crazy things, because I'm sure that I am, I just don't know it; and if I did, I probably would not admit it, not even to myself. To be perfectly honest, most of my crazy talk comes from reading between the lines; the problem with doing that, is that you make too many assumptions and don't stick to the facts. I try to listen to "To Every Man An Answer" as much as I can, mostly because I believe Pastor Mike tries very hard to stick to the Text and not assume God is saying something that He isn't saying. Every once in a while he might stray, but if he does, it's only because it's an issue that he is passionate about. He is only a man like we are, so what do you expect. However, we need to be careful about the things that we are passionate about, because if our passion is in anything else but Christ, we could be taken off course. Much like Paul says in 1 Corinthians 2:2, "For I am determined not to know any thing among you, save Jesus Christ, and him crucified." It's called 'Getting back to the basics,' which pretty much is the same as saying, "Get back to Square One!" There is something interesting about what Jesus said to Nicodemus about those that love darkness rather than light, and it has to do with revealing sin. I tend to think that we can make a habit of not revealing sins; which is actually a pretty stupid thing to do, because there is nothing that is hidden from God. Neither is there really anything hidden from ourselves. We know when we sin; and if we pretend that we don't, we are basically just fooling our own conscience, which really can't be fooled. And besides that, what about the Holy Spirit? Oh, you must not ever forget about Him...
"Don't you realize that all of you together are the temple of God and that the Holy Spirit lives in you? God will destroy anyone who destroys this temple. For God's temple is holy, and you are that temple. Stop deceiving yourselves. If you think you are wise by this world's standards, you need to become a fool to be truly wise. For the wisdom of this world is foolishness to God. As the Scriptures say, "He traps the wise in the snare of their own cleverness." And again, "The LORD knows the thoughts of the wise; he knows they are worthless."" (1 Corinthians 3:16-20) NLT
